1.1 This test method covers the chemical analysis of zinc alloys having chemical compositions within the following limits:
Element |
Composition Range, % |
Aluminum |
3.0-8.0 |
Antimony |
0.002 max |
Cadmium |
0.025 max |
Cerium |
0.03-0.10 |
Copper |
0.10 max |
Iron |
0.10 max |
Lanthanum |
0.03-0.10 |
Lead |
0.026 max |
Magnesium |
0.05 max |
Silicon |
0.015 max |
Tin |
0.002 max |
Titanium |
0.02 max |
Zirconium |
0.02 max |
1.2 The values stated in SI units are to be regarded as standard. No other units of measurement are included in this standard.
1.3 Included are procedures for elements in the following composition ranges:
Element |
Composition Range, % |
Aluminum |
3.0-8.0 |
Cadmium |
0.0016-0.025 |
Cerium |
0.005-0.10 |
Iron |
0.0015-0.10 |
Lanthanum |
0.009-0.10 |
Lead |
0.002-0.026 |
